Yes. A joint tenant can convey their interest in real property and thus break the survivorship rights of the co-tenant. A tenant-by-the-entirety cannot defeat the survivorship rights of the co-tenant. In most jurisdictions, a divorce would automatically convert a T by E to a tenancy in common.

If Patrick and Sean own property as tenants in common and Patrick dies then his next-of-kin will inherit his interest in the property unless he left a will devising it to a particular person. If there is no will his interest in the property will pass according to the state laws of intestacy. You can check the laws in your state at the link below.
